Walk through the rows, touch and taste the grapes, and savor the view from the summit of our hillside vineyard. See for yourself how elevation, orientation, and soil type work together to make Lenne's an ideal place to grow spectacular Pinot Noir and Chardonnay.
Tours are guided by our Winemaker Steve Lutz or our Lead Wine Educator Eric Bruce. Your guide will walk you through the vines and along the rows, up and down hills, and pour you several wines during the experience. See first hand how vines are grafted and pruned, how trellising works, how we deal with vine and grape maturation, what goes into canopy management, the pros and cons of dry farming, weed and pest control, and much more.
Tours are priced at $85 per guest, accomodate 2-12 individuals, and run about 90 minutes. There is only one tour per day, at 11am. (We can sometimes arrange other times appointment on weekdays. The $85 fee can be waived with a purchase of $350 or more.)
We pace the walking with sipping and gazing, but be aware that there is some uphill hiking required. Please wear practical shoes. You will be walking through a working vineyard and footing can be slippery on gravel, grass, and earth.
